Cognitive behavioral therapy

Cognitive behavioral therapy, also referred to as cognitive behavior therapy, is one of the most effective treatments for ADHD. It will help you manage daily challenges and alter the way you think about your life and yourself.

Although it's not a cure for ADHD but it can make life much simpler. If you are struggling with a daily task such as completing a report or getting up in time, a CBT session can aid.

Among other things, CBT teaches you how to manage your time better and motivates you to get out of bed each day. CBT is generally covered by the majority of mental health insurance plans. It is crucial to choose the right therapist for you.

Ask your provider about their experience with CBT for ADHD. This will help you select the best therapist. Ask your family and friends for recommendations. Some therapists provide sliding scale rates. Stimulants

Stimulants are drugs that help treat att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der. They are effective when combined with behavioral therapy. The stimulants can be addictive. Patients and their families have to be aware of the advantages and the risks.

Medications for ADHD improve social skills, shorl.com reduce hyperactivity, and improve attention span. They may also enhance school performance.

The stimulants are typically given at an initial dose of a small amount for in the beginning. The dose is gradually increased until symptoms disappear. Consult your physician if you notice side effects.

Addiction can arise from ADHD medication. This can happen in the event of an history of drug or alcohol abuse. It is important to monitor [Redirect Only] any changes in behavior of your child following the introduction of the medication.

There are three types of drugs for ADHD including stimulants, non-stimulants as well as alpha-adrenergic agonists. Stimulants are typically prescribed in pill form, while non-stimulants may be taken in patch or liquid form.

Stimulants can cause issues such as nervousness, headaches and stomach pain. You can minimize these effects by taking the medication with food. It is possible to lessen side effects by taking the medication at the exact time every day.

Anxiety symptoms can also be aggravated by stimulants. It is important to be aware of changes in mood and behavior. In addition, stimulants may induce sleepiness.

Negative reactions may occur in people with comorbid conditions like depression or anxiety. Patients should be referred for medical attention from a specialist in this case.

To treat symptoms related to other medical conditions, medications may also be prescribed. For example children with ADHD who has had a history of tics, or depression may benefit from using an alternative to stimulants.

Children may need to test multiple drugs before they find the one that is right for them. Parents and caregivers need to be aware of the child's reactions to medications.

Tai Chi

Incorporating Tai Chi as a treatment for ADHD can help reduce disruptive behaviors. It can also help improve motor control.

Several studies have investigated movement-based approaches as a possible ADHD treatment for adhd in adults uk. One study on tai-chi in healthy young adults showed promising results. Another study of middle schoolers found that tai chi reduced hyperactivity.

Research on ADHD adolescents has also demonstrated meditation and mindfulness to be beneficial. However, the evidence is mixed. There are a number of factors that contribute to the lack of good quality data.

The study of thirteen adult adhd treatment uk teens showed positive effects of tai chi. They were more disciplined as well as less anxiety and daydreaming, and also showed an improvement in inappropriate emotions. But the findings did not endure multiple comparison correction.

Despite its potential, more studies are required. To assess the long-term effects on the long-term effects, more controlled studies that are randomized are needed.

The research conducted by the University of Miami School of Medicine discovered that Tai Chi has a positive effect on ADHD adolescents who exhibit anxiety, impulsivity, conduct, and the impulsivity. Researchers didn't think about the confounding effects of recreational or medical drugs.

Although these studies are preliminary but they could pave the way for future research. Future work may include extending the study to other groups of young adults.

Tai Chi is an ideal mindful exercise program for ADHD. It involves slow, deliberate, and concentrated movements designed to improve attention to an activity. As such, it may be an effective alternative to prescription drugs.

Tai Chi may provide long-lasting benefits for ADHD, which can aid in the path towards recovery. However, it's essential to regularly practice the exercise.

Changes in nutrition

Many ADHD cases are treatable with nutritional changes. A healthy diet can help prevent deficiency in nutrients, improve the brain's ability to process information, and improve cognitive function. However, addressing ADHD symptoms with diet changes isn't a one-size-fits-all solution. People who wish to take supplements for their diet should consult with their physician to determine if they are appropriate for them.

Numerous studies have demonstrated that food additives, like artificial colors, may affect ADHD. For instance, children with ADHD have been observed to be more prone to hyperactivity when exposed food coloring.

In addition to limiting the amount of food additives in your diet It's also essential to consume enough protein and healthy fats. Protein aids in maintaining alertness in the brain and keeps the mind in check. A healthy diet is a mix of fresh whole foods.

Foods considered to be brain-friendly include dark leafy green vegetables and legumes. They are loaded with fiber, which reduces the absorption of sugar.

There is no evidence to suggest that a poor diet causes ADHD however, a high-sugar, fat-rich diet can cause more symptoms in children. It is recommended to eat whole fruits and vegetables, reduce processed sugar and adhere to a low fat, low sugar diet.

There are also certain minerals and vitamins that could influence the symptoms of a child. ADHD is more likely to occur among children who are deficient in certain minerals , like zinc or iron.

Supplementing your child's diet may aid in addressing nutrient deficiencies. Megadoses of minerals or vitamins may cause harm, so be sure to consult your doctor before deciding if supplements are appropriate.
